Come ready to play, cheer each other on, and create lasting memories at this adaptive sports camp designed for campers ages 10-17 who are blind or low vision (BLV)! Paralympic athletes will join Camp T staff and members of the Michigan Blind Athletic Association to guide campers through exciting team challenges, skill-building activities, and friendly competition. Participants will explore a variety of games and adaptive sports, including goalball, a Paralympic team sport created specifically for athletes who are BLV. The weekend will conclude with an exciting goalball tournament taking place on Sunday morning!
